Facts 

Name:SANDY BLVD over HWY 2 I-84 & LRT TRACKS
Structure number:07026A059 00191
Location:3.0 MI E OF PORTLAND CC
Purpose:Carries highway and pedestrian walkway over highway and railroad
Route classification:Other Principal Arterial (Urban) [14]
Length of largest span:75.1 ft. [22.9 m]
Total length:185.0 ft. [56.4 m]
Roadway width between curbs:65.0 ft. [19.8 m]
Deck width edge-to-edge:76.1 ft. [23.2 m]
Vertical clearance below bridge:16.1 ft. [4.9 m]
Skew angle:42°
Owner:City or Municipal Highway Agency [04]
Year built:1984
Historic significance:Bridge is not eligible for the National Register of Historic Places [5]
Design load:MS 22.5 / HS 25 [9]
Number of main spans:3
Main spans material:Prestressed concrete [5]
Main spans design:Box beam or girders - Multiple [05]
Deck type:Concrete Cast-in-Place [1]
Wearing surface:Bituminous [6]
